WebYou take these medications about half an hour before meals, up to three times a day. They are similar to sulphonylureas, but work faster to stimulate insulin production and don’t last long. If you miss a meal, don’t take them. They could cause low blood sugar levels, also called hypoglycaemia. Pioglitazone (Actos®)
